Question

La flock La page Utility Man donne l'exemple d'utilisation suivant:

(
    flock -s 200
    # ... commands executed under lock ...
) 200>/var/lock/mylockfile

En supposant 200 Le fichier est-il le fichier du fichier de verrouillage, y a-t-il une possibilité que pendant une exécution, il échoue, car le même fichier est déjà utilisé par un autre processus? Si c'est le cas, y a-t-il des astuces pour s'assurer de verrouiller avec flock fonctionne de manière fiable?

Pas de solution correcte

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top